Stade Rennais Football Club, commonly known as Stade Rennais or simply Rennes, is a prominent professional football club based in Rennes, France. Founded in 1901, the club has a rich history and has made significant strides in French football, particularly in Ligue 1, the top tier of the French football league system. With its headquarters in Brittany, Stade Rennais has established itself as a key player in the industry, focusing on competitive football and youth development. The club is renowned for its passionate fan base and its commitment to nurturing local talent through its academy. Notable achievements include winning the Coupe de France and consistently competing in European tournaments, which solidifies its market position as a respected force in French football.

Stade Rennais Football Club currently does not have available data on carbon emissions, as no specific emissions figures have been provided. Additionally, there are no documented reduction targets or climate pledges outlined in their initiatives. This absence of data suggests that the club may still be in the early stages of formalising its climate commitments or reporting on its carbon footprint. In the context of the football industry, many clubs are increasingly recognising the importance of sustainability and are working towards reducing their environmental impact. However, without specific information, it is difficult to assess Stade Rennais' current position or future commitments regarding carbon emissions and climate action.
